趋势是,越来越多的办公软件开始考虑移动端,甚至移动为先。...这几大类软件中,专业工具因为特定的工作环境要求,依然极度依赖PC,离移动设备依然很遥远;企业信息化类本身便是WEB应用居多,迁移到移动端更为容易;面临最大的挑战和机遇的是常规工具类中的文档处理软件。...因此,文档处理软件在移动端面临巨大挑战。 同时,因为人们在移动场景下浏览、更新、同步、分享文档的刚需,文档处理App也迎来前所未有的机会。...还有办公软件这一典型的沉浸式应用。 可以看一组数据。最大的移动办公应用,金山WPS已在全球拥有2亿用户,支持超过44种语言。...微软按份卖拷贝的软件思维已经落伍,软件免费加载增值服务收费的模式盛况空前。这是WPS的机遇。 办公软件正在被移动革命。你很难再在移动设备上看到Office那几个经典的图标了。
公钥和私钥通常有可以互相加解密的特性: 将原始信息用公钥加密后,可以使用私钥解密; 将原始信息用私钥加密后,通常可以使用公钥解密。...一般公钥是对所有人公开的,原始数据使用公钥加密后,只有拥有私钥的人才能解密。 也就是说只有公钥的情况下是无法解开加密的数据的。
软件定义的性能: Solana 的设计原则之一是利用现代硬件的优势,包括多核处理器、高速存储器和网络接口,以软件定义的方式实现高性能。
使用公钥私钥 密码配送的原因就在于对称加密使用的密钥是相同的。如果我们使用非对称加密算法(公钥只用来加密,私钥只用来解密),这个问题是不是就能够解决了?...回到小明和小红通信的问题,如果小红事先生成了公钥私钥,并把公钥发给了小明,则小明可以将情书使用公钥进行加密,然后发给小红,这个情书只有小红才能解密。即使公钥被窃听了也没有关系。...当然这里也有一个问题,就是小明要确保生成的公钥的确是小红发出来的。这个问题的解决方法我们会在后面讨论。 公钥密钥还有一个问题就是速度的问题,只有对称加密算法的几百分之一。...下面画个序列图,解释一下公钥密码的交互流程: ?
公链通常被认为是“完全去中心化”的,因为没有任何个人或者机构可以控制或篡改其中数据的读写。...公链的任何区块对外公开,任何人都可以发送价值。区块链通过去中心化,以及让人信赖的方式一起维护一个可信的数据库账簿。简单来讲,区块链技术就是一种所有人都参与记账的方式。...公链一般会通过代币机制(Token)来鼓励参与者竞争记账,来确保数据的安全性。从应用上说,区块链公链包括比特币、以太坊、超级账本、大多数山寨币以及智能合约,其中区块链公链的始祖是比特币区块链。...底层公链就相当于区块链世界的基础设施,解决方案用来拓展底层公链的性能或为商业应用提供服务支撑。只有在底层公链扎实稳健高效运转的基础上,区块链商业应用才能发展和落地。...公链在整个区块链领域的重要性和必要性,发展空间和需求都非常大。不过如何正确分辨出它的优势和问题,且脚踏实地去开拓应用领域,现在还需要一些时日。
一.node启动js公钥加密 //需要导入模块npm install node-forge var arguments = process.argv.splice(2); // console.log...o).toString(); // fs.writeFile(name, data, function (error) {}); console.log(data); //进行输出 二.python公钥加密...# 公钥加密 import base64 import rsa from Crypto.PublicKey import RSA def encryptPassword(password, publicKeyStr...): ''' password:密码 publicKeyStr:公钥 ''' # 1、base64解码 publicKeyBytes = base64.b64decode
全球十大公链有哪些? 2、ETH 以太坊市值2970.91亿美元,总发行量1.15亿美元,24小时成交额203.34亿美元。 以太坊(Ethereum)是一个面向分布式运用的全球开源渠道。...全球十大公链有哪些? 4、ADA 爱达币市值405.13亿美元,总发行量319.48亿美元,24小时成交额33.77亿美元。 Cardano根据同行评议的学术研讨,表现了敞开和透明的精神。...全球十大公链有哪些? 8、EOS EOS市值55.76亿美元,总发行量9.51亿美元,24小时成交额30.72亿美元。...全球十大公链有哪些? 10、 ETC ETC市值37.88亿美元,总发行量1.16亿美元,24小时成交额39.51亿美元。...全球十大公链有哪些? 以上内容是全球十大公链的具体内容介绍。当然,除了本文介绍的公链,还有其他的公链。出资人在挑选其他公链项目的时候,一定要清楚,不是一切的公链项目都有出资潜力,尤其是初入币圈的人。
复杂美公链技术Chain33从11月开源至今,获得众多合作方的认可,其中首创的平行公链架构被百度、阿里、360等机构认可并跟进研究,这也说明了平行公链或许是区块链普及应用的重要解决方案之一。...、初创公司部署公链的首选。...1、什么是平行公链?首先你需要理解什么是公链?公链就是对所有人开放,人人都可以参与竞争记帐的区块链,如比特币、以太坊,公链需要节点多而分散才更安全。...公链有独立的钱包、独立的区块链浏览器、区块链上可进行应用开发等。平行公链简称平行链,对所有人开放,隶属公链领域。目前已在比特元公链上落地实践。...看上去就是完全独立的公链,帮助需要公链生态的企业、项目方。2、平行公链有哪些优势?
公链开发和公链NFT商城是两个不同的概念,但是在实际应用中它们可以相互结合。公链开发是指基于区块链技术,开发一个能够支持多种应用的完整的公共区块链网络。...公链NFT商城的开发需要基于公链开发,通过开发智能合约实现NFT的发行、交易等功能,并在公链网络上搭建一个可靠的交易平台。...2.设计公链协议:公链协议是指规定公链网络的通信协议、数据结构、验证规则等一系列规范。设计良好的公链协议可以确保公链的稳定性和可靠性。...3.开发公链节点:公链节点是指运行在公链网络上的节点,节点之间通过P2P网络通信。公链节点需要实现区块链的基本功能,包括交易验证、区块同步、共识算法等。...5.实现共识算法:公链需要实现共识算法,确保节点间达成一致,保证公链的安全性和可信度。6.测试和优化:公链开发完成后,需要进行充分的测试和优化,确保公链网络的稳定性、安全性和高效性。
什么是公链:公链又叫“公链”,公链是指国际上任何人都能够读取和发送买卖,而且买卖能够有效确认,还能够参加一致进程的区块链。 根据区块链网络的中心化程度,不同使用场景下的区块链有三种:1。...图片 公链的作用:1。公链能够维护用户权益不受程序开发者的影响:在公链中,程序开发者无权干涉用户,所以公链能够维护用户运用这个程序的权益。...公链可使用于实践业务场景:除金融使用外,任何对信任、安全、耐久化要求较高的使用场景,如财物挂号、投票、办理、物联网等。,会大规模受到公链的影响。 有哪些公链项目:(排名不分先后)1。...同时采用了权限一致机制(PoS),为商业使用和分布式移动使用供给了无限或许。 然而,Pos机制存在固有的问题。...Cardano采用独立的SDK(软件开发工具包)系统,让个人技能人员参加游戏开发和供给,发生游戏竞技,提高游戏质量。 5。
复杂美公链技术Chain33从11月开源至今,获得众多合作方的认可,其中首创的平行公链架构被百度、阿里、360等机构认可并跟进研究,这也说明了平行公链或许是区块链普及应用的重要解决方案之一。...、初创公司部署公链的首选。...图片1、什么是平行公链?首先你需要理解什么是公链?公链就是对所有人开放,人人都可以参与竞争记帐的区块链,如比特币、以太坊,公链需要节点多而分散才更安全。...公链有独立的钱包、独立的区块链浏览器、区块链上可进行应用开发等。平行公链简称平行链,对所有人开放,隶属公链领域。目前已在比特元公链上落地实践。...看上去就是完全独立的公链,帮助需要公链生态的企业、项目方。2、平行公链有哪些优势?
公链形式体系开发方案剖析: 公链是区块链中的每个节点都是敞开的。每个人都能够参加区块链的计算,每个人都能够经过下载取得完整的区块链数据,也被称为区块链账本。...简而言之,底层公链相当于区块链世界的基础设施,解决方案用于扩展底层公链的性能或许为商业运用供给服务支撑。区块链的商业运用只要在底层公链厚实、稳健、高效运营的基础上才干发展和落地。...公链一般经过令牌机制鼓舞参加者竞赛记账,以确保数据的安全性。从运用来看,区块链公链包含比特币、以太坊、超级账本、大部分假币和智能合约,其间区块链公链的鼻祖是比特币区块链。...这个区块链产品被称为公链。 一句话总结,就像咱们电脑的操作体系是Windows相同,公链其实便是区块链世界的操作体系。 确保公链安稳运转的关键在于特定的一致机制。...公链的功能 1.保护用户权益不受程序开发者的影响 在公链中,程序的开发者无权干涉用户,所以公链能够保护运用程序的用户的权益。此外,高度去中心化的分布式数据存储也是公链最大的特色之一。
广告app 2019年,发现广告软件威胁的数量显著增加,其目的是在移动设备上获取个人数据。统计显示,2019年被广告软件攻击的用户数量与2018年基本持平。 ?...按2019年受到攻击的用户数量计算,前十大移动威胁中有四个是广告软件类应用。 ? 2019年,移动广告软件开发商不仅生成了数万个软件包,在技术上也做了提升,特别是绕过了操作系统的限制。...数据分析 2019年,发现移动恶意安装软件3503952个,比上年减少1817190个。 ?...TOP20移动恶意软件 ?...由于其他类别和系列移动恶意软件的活动减少,银行木马在所有检测到的威胁中所占的份额略有增加。 ?
原因 通过密码进行ssh连接存在被暴力破解的可能,但在禁用密码登录+修改22端口+禁用root登录之后,可以将被暴力破解的概率降到最低,且通过private_key登录服务器更适合shell操作 生成公钥
鲍勃有两把钥匙,一把是公钥,另一把是私钥。 鲍勃把公钥送给他的朋友们----帕蒂、道格、苏珊----每人一把。 苏珊要给鲍勃写一封保密的信。她写完后用鲍勃的公钥加密,就可以达到保密的效果。...道格想欺骗苏珊,他偷偷使用了苏珊的电脑,用自己的公钥换走了鲍勃的公钥。此时,苏珊实际拥有的是道格的公钥,但是还以为这是鲍勃的公钥。...因此,道格就可以冒充鲍勃,用自己的私钥做成"数字签名",写信给苏珊,让苏珊用假的鲍勃公钥进行解密。 后来,苏珊感觉不对劲,发现自己无法确定公钥是否真的属于鲍勃。...她想到了一个办法,要求鲍勃去找"证书中心"(certificate authority,简称CA),为公钥做认证。...苏珊收信后,用CA的公钥解开数字证书,就可以拿到鲍勃真实的公钥了,然后就能证明"数字签名"是否真的是鲍勃签的。 下面,我们看一个应用"数字证书"的实例:https协议。这个协议主要用于网页加密。
文章前言 本系列文章将结合以太坊公链源码对公链设计进行深入剖析解读,涉及范围包括但不仅限于以下几点: 公链设计架构 公链启动过程 公链交互工具 公链接口设计 公链区块设计 公链交易处理 公链智能合约 公链虚拟机类...公链P2P网络 公链数据存储 公链共识算法 公链挖矿流程 区块链技术 区块链技术起源于2008年中本聪发表的名为《Bitcoin: A Peer-to-Peer Electronic Cash System...联盟链:由若干个机构联合发起,介于公链和私链之间,兼部分去中心化特性,网络中的节点部分可以任意接入,另一部分则必须通过授权才可以接入,比如:清算系统 区块链技术经历了以下几个阶段: 区块链 1.0:数字货币的去中心化化...是简历在区块链上的代码运行环境,其主要左右是处理以太坊系统内的智能合约 RPC:远程过程调用,为一个节点请求另一个节点提供的服务,提供外部访问能力 核心层:区块链协议、共识算法、挖矿管理、分布式网络组件 基础库:公链基础应用库
移动通信经历了四个阶段性发展。第五代移动通信系统( 5G )将在全面支持物联网业态的同时,相当程度上为移动互联网服务体验给出升级解决方案,实现:人与人——人与物——物与物 间结构性的智能连接。...与4G相比, 5G在用户体验,NA公链挖矿对接薇13622951连接频次,移动性,流量频次,端到端延迟,频谱效率,能效,成本等方面的要求提高了1-2个数量级。实现了真正的移动通信网络架构。...进入5G时代之后,NA公链挖矿对接薇13622951网络将会在更大程度上覆盖于日常生活,具体涉及城市建设、构建新的环境生态、生产线以及家居等多样化的层面,全球的公民生活将会体现为全方位的改进。...移动消费互联网已经具备相当规模,以Uber为例,如果您使用过该软件并添加个人信息,后台将会自动识别您的地理位置并通过大数据分析显示您常去的地点与可能出行的位置信息。...使用N&A dual chain可以实现交易各方交易实时同步记账、分布式存储(我们基于DDS的基础开发了全新的普朗克常数存储), 在交易入账的同时就通过DPOP共识机制实现交易的验证、NA公链挖矿对接薇
OpenGL(九)-- 综合案例(公、自转) 相信学习过OpenGL的同学应该过玩过这个经典案例: ?...绘制公转小球 void drawSomething(GLfloat yRot){ //压栈 modelViewMatrix.PushMatrix(); //先旋转在移动...; sphereSmallBatch.Draw(); modelViewMatrix.PopMatrix(); } 小球先旋转,旋转后导致物体的方向向量的角度也发生了变化,所以x轴的移动会按照向量方向进行...先移动并不会改变物体的方向向量,也就无法完成公转的效果。...完整的代码见github- 综合案例(公、自转)
我们对这种做法有所疑问,并坚信即使在移动 AI 时代,软件仍将主导业界。我们的中心论点是,深度学习应用程序的软件优化潜力仍未得到充分开发。...我们得出的结论是,即使在移动 AI 时代,软件仍在占有并将持续占有整个业界,并且通过纯软件压缩编译协同设计在数十亿个现有移动设备和数万亿个新兴的物联网设备上启用实时 AI 应用程序是最切实可行的方法。...这不禁使我们思考,专用硬件加速是正确的道路,还是软件仍然主导移动 AI 时代?...结果显示,我们团队提出的压缩编译协同设计软件算法方案可以在移动平台上实现令人满意的高速实时效果。...即使在移动 AI 时代,软件仍然占据主宰地位 我们这篇文章的核心观点是即使在 AI 时代,软件仍将主导业界。
2022 年 2 月以来,研究人员发现欧洲的移动恶意软件传播增加了 500%。随着攻击者将目标转向移动端,移动端的攻击行为正在稳步增加。...△ 传播高峰 现今的移动恶意软件不仅仅是窃取凭据,还有可能进行位置跟踪、数据擦除、音视频记录等恶意行为。...安卓与苹果 大多数移动端的恶意软件还是通过应用商店进行传播的,但在过去一年,通过短信传播的行为有所增加。...移动恶意软件业态 移动恶意软件也正在变得越来越先进,除了数据窃密外还会产生更大的影响: 记录电话与非电话通话 录制设备视频与音频 销毁或擦除数据 相比通过钓鱼网站引诱用于输入凭据,移动恶意软件可以在用户使用金融应用程序时进行窃密...常见恶意软件 攻击者通常会根据语言、地区和设备调整攻击行动: △ 常见恶意软件 FluBot 2020 年 11 月,FluBot 在西班牙被发现,后来传播到英国、德国、澳大利亚、新西兰、西班牙
领取专属 10元无门槛券
手把手带您无忧上云